Frank Perry Research Travel Scholarship in Engineering

Applications open Monday 27 April 2026
Applications close Friday 29 May 2026
Total value $10,000
Duration Once off payment
Residency International Student, New Zealand Citizen, Australian Citizen
Level of study Graduate research
Degree All
College All
Type of scholarship Travel scholarships, Graduate research
The Frank Perry Research Travel Scholarship was established in 1974 using funds from the Frank and Hilda Perry Trust. The travel scholarship is to support Graduate Research candidates in engineering to undertake interstate or overseas travel to present at a peer-reviewed conference.

The Scholarship is only to be used towards travel costs, specifically conference registration, flights and accommodation. The Scholarship is not available for ‘virtual’ conferences, only for physical travel.

Successful applicants will receive funding to a value determined by the selection committee based on the application provided.

Eligibility

To be eligible to apply for this scholarship, you must:

  • be enrolled in a Graduate Research program at the University in the area of Engineering; and
  • be enrolled in the second year of a Master of Philosophy, or the second or third year of a Doctor of Philosophy; and
  • have successfully completed relevant candidature milestones.

Selection criteria

The scholarship will be awarded via a competitive selection process managed by the Adelaide University Graduate Research School, based on academic merit, research potential, benefit of the outlined travel to the applicant’s Graduate Research program, and relevance to engineering.
